Q: Is 363,394 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 363,394 is a composite number.

Why is 363,394 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 363,394 can be evenly divided by 1 2 19 38 73 131 146 262 1,387 2,489 2,774 4,978 9,563 19,126 181,697 and 363,394, with no remainder.

Since 363,394 cannot be divided by just 1 and 363,394, it is a composite number.
